Midtown Bay

• Part of a mixed-use development Guoco Midtown that comprises premium Grade A office space, public and retail spaces, exclusive residences, and the former Beach Road Police Station, a conserved building.

• Located within Central Business District, at the intersection of two key development corridors  along Beach Road and Ophir-Rochor Road.

• Key connector between 3 office micromarkets – City Hall, Marina Centre & Bugis.

• Served by four MRT lines and Nicoll Highway, as well as the North-South Expressway in the future.
